[21] “It is better not to eat meat or drink wine or to do anything else that will cause your brother or sister to fall.” – Romans 14:21 (NIV)
Once, I had a conversation with a friend who was living with a married couple for a while. Because of his presence in the house, he usually notices when the couple gets into problems with each other. But to his surprise, this couple never displays their frustration in front of their children. I never bothered about it because I was about eighteen years old then. But as I grew older and nearing marriage, I realised how important it is for kids not to be affected by the marital problems of their parents, especially in the early stages of their lives. If it happens, it leaves such a bad impression about marriage in their minds, of which only God’s Word can bring all those things down. Today, it is sad that some people are going around not believing in the efficacy of godly marriages because their parents failed them. What a tragedy! What am I saying?
The Bible cautions that a believer in Christ should not do anything that will cause another child of God to fall. That means the actions of other people who have been in the faith for quite a while and matured spiritually have an influence on others. In fact, I can say that one of the places people observe things a lot is the church. Because of that, there are several gossipers in many churches. It is everywhere, including even the smallest church in the world.
God has set you free in Christ to live unto Him and not to use your life to indulge in the desires of the flesh. Therefore, there is a charge on your life to be careful in your way of life. Do not do things that will cause other believers to fall because there are people in the faith who are like little children, unable to bear the faults of mature believers in Christ.
